Hi all,

Can anyone tell me if when you Video Render that any Audio that happens to be in the Band in a Box file is not rendered along with the instruments.


I have sent the following text to PG Music Support.

Would it be possible to add any Audio (that is in the file) to the Video Render (not to show it, but to hear it with the song)
I have a Band in a Box file with audio (me singing) and when I render to video the audio doesn’t play.
I think that would be good as you could upload your song to YouTube, or wherever, and showcase Band in a Box with your audio sounding along with it.

The videos include any audio that you normally hear in your song. If you render your song to an audio file, that would be the same audio as the video. So your own audio track should be included, as long as it is not muted in the mixer.

Do you hear your audio track when you play the song?

If you try rendering your song to a WAV file, do you hear your audio track in the WAV file?

Handy flash drive tip: Always try plugging in a USB device the wrong way first? If your flash drive (or other USB plug) doesn't have a symbol to indicate which way is up, look for the side with a seam on the metal connector (it only has a line across one side) - that's the side that either faces down or to the left, depending on your port placement.
